Job description
The Membership/Database Specialist is an integral part of a team-oriented and results driven area of the Al Wooten Jr. Youth Center. The position is responsible for the accurate inputting of member information and the tracking of the programs and outcomes that the students participate in. The specialist is responsible for supporting and performing the organization’s membership database functions utilizing Kid Trax membership program and utilizing the Apricot system to adhere to data entry and tracing of outcomes and participation of students. To successfully fulfill this role, the Specialist should be highly detailed orientated with a critical degree of accuracy regarding data entry. The role also requires heavy computer and office-based responsibilities.

HOURS: Mon-Fri. 1pm-5pm. Some Saturdays may be required with notice

RESPONSIBILITIES

· Support the organization’s strategic use of data to further the goals and processing of the membership objectives.
· Collaborate with program staff to ensure that all data relating to the programs and activities that youth are participating in are captured in membership and database programs
· Ensure that data that is being inputted is accurate
· Provide reports to directors and other staff when instructed to. Information should be able to be explained with appropriate details
· Act as an internal trainer with membership and database systems in tools when necessary
· Assess and update database documentation processes and procedures when necessary
· Invite and build upon the ideas and input of others
· Communicate with parents and assist them in the using of the membership system when necessary
· Establish proper policies and procedures are put in place that allows trouble shooting when membership and database systems are not functioning properly
· When instructed, attend community and agency events to promote the Al Wooten Jr Youth Center and the programs and activities that are provided to the youth and their families
· Supports basic office duties and responsibilities including answering office phone calls and customer service functions

QUALIFICATIONS

· 1-3 years of related experience or equivalent combination of education and experience. Bachelor’s degree preferred
· 1-3 years of applicable database experience required; hands on experience with membership base and or database programs preferred
· Exceptional organizational, analytical and problem-solving skills
· Excellent interpersonal and customer relations skills, including the ability to provide technical support to others of all levels and backgrounds
· High level of discretion, professionalism and confidentiality required
· Demonstrated ability to work both as a team member and independently with minimal supervision in a time sensitive environment
· Proficiency in utilizing Microsoft Office 365 and Google platform utilities
· Excellent oral and written communication skills with the ability to deliver clear and effective messages to all staff members, students and their families
